The Las Cruces Bulldawgs will square off against the La Cueva Bears at 1:00 p.m. on Saturday. Las Cruces is strutting in with some offensive muscle as they've averaged 26.4 points per game this season.
Las Cruces is on a roll after a high-stakes playoff matchup on Friday. They strolled past Volcano Vista with points to spare, taking the game 17-3. The 17-point effort marked the Bulldawgs' lowest-scoring matchup of the season, but in the end it didn't matter.
Daniel Amaro continued his habit of posting crazy stat lines, rushing for 115 yards and two touchdowns. Amaro is crushing it when it comes to rushing touchdowns: he's punched in at least two every time he's taken the field this season.
Meanwhile, La Cueva put another one in the bag on Saturday to keep their perfect season alive. They breezed by Hobbs to the tune of 57-6. Considering the Bears have won ten contests by more than 20 points this season, Saturday's blowout was nothing new.
La Cueva pushed their record up to 11-0 with the victory, which was their 13th straight at home dating back to last season. Those victories were due in large part to their defensive effort, having only surrendered 10.3 points per game. As for Las Cruces, they have been performing incredibly well recently as they've won seven of their last eight games, which provided a nice bump to their 9-3 record this season.
Las Cruces took a serious blow against La Cueva in their previous meeting back in November of 2023, falling 63-33. A big factor in that loss was the dominant performance of La Cueva's Cameron Dyer, who rushed for 200 yards and three touchdowns on only 13 carries, and also threw for 370 yards and two touchdowns on only 18 passes.
